Author:Dalby, Richard. Neglected vampire classics including tales by Sir Arthur Conan Doyle, Louisa May Alcott and others. Dracula's Brethren (Collins Chillers). Book Binding:Paperback / softback. In 1897, Bram Stokers iconic DRACULA redefined the horror genre and had a significant impact on the image of the vampire in popular culture.
